概括
第一个早晨的尿样可靠量化α-1-微型血球蛋白,与24小时的样本有很好的相关性,并且不受年龄或性别的影响. 升高的水平可能表明早期的管管损伤,特别是在糖尿病或高血压患者.

背景情况:
- 阿尔法-1-微型球蛋白量化的标准是24小时的尿液,但第一天早上的空气不太受膜过率的影响.
- 关于年龄和性别对α-1-微型血球蛋白测量的影响,存在相互矛盾的数据.
研究的目的:
- 评估第一个早晨尿样的可靠性,以量化α-1-微型血球蛋白.
- 评估第一天早上和24小时尿液α-1-微型血球蛋白水平之间的相关性.
- 确定年龄和性别对这些测量的影响.
主要方法:
- 分析了434个尿液测试,包括具有不同膜过率的样本.
- 在第一个早晨尿液中的α-1-微型球蛋白水平与24小时尿液样本 (n=42) 的比较.
- 统计分析以评估基于年龄和性别的相关性和差异.
主要成果:
- 在第一天早上和24小时尿液α-1-微型血球蛋白测量之间观察到强烈的相关性 (0.92).
- 对于年龄或性别的肌素校正水平,没有发现统计学上显著的差异.
- 在77%的病例中,第一个早晨尿液水平升高 (>7.08 (mg/L) /g肌) 与高血压或糖尿病有关.
结论:
- 第一个早晨的尿液是对α-1-微型血球蛋白量化的一个可行的替代方案,因为它与24小时样本的相关性以及与年龄/性别的独立性.
- 第一次早晨尿液水平超过7.08 (mg/L) /g的肌氨酸值得怀疑早期管道损伤,特别是在高血压或糖尿病患者中.
